#b84b1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b84b1c is composed of 72.2% red, 29.4%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.2% magenta, 84.8%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 18.1 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 41.6%. #b84b1c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9638 with #710000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b84b1c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0602 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b84b1c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6865 is the less saturated color, while #d04104 is the most saturated one.
